Tour Information

The exhibits are open to visitors during regular Museum hours.  Feel free to come stroll and learn at your own pace.  Cub Scout and Boy Scout activity patches can also be completed at any time.
Guided tours provide a personalized experience for museum visitors including hands-on experiences and additional insight into the exhibits.  Tours must be scheduled at least one week in advance.  Please refer to the pricing chart for tour fee information.  Tours are usually 45 minutes long, but can be adapted to the needs of the group.  As you plan your visit, keep in mind that the Museum can handle a maximum of 40 visitors at a time.

Guided tours can be scheduled in the following areas:
Gallery Tours
Themed Tour with Hands on Activity
Gallery tours introduce visitors to one or both of the current exhibits.
Themed tours begin in the gallery then transition to a hands on activity. 
  • Archeology - Explore the science of digging as you find your own buried treasures. (Weather permitting)
  • Pottery - Discover how ancient pottery was made and construct your own pot.
  • Kachinas - Discover the Kachina cult of the Pueblo cultures in the Southwest and create your own kachina to take home
